diff --git a/hindsight-api/hindsight_api/engine/cross_encoder.py b/hindsight-api/hindsight_api/engine/cross_encoder.py index 51957180..7d70c147 100644 --- a/hindsight-api/hindsight_api/engine/cross_encoder.py +++ b/hindsight-api/hindsight_api/engine/cross_encoder.py @@ -163,11 +163,101 @@ class LocalSTCrossEncoder(CrossEncoderModel): else: logger.info("Reranker: local provider initialized (using existing executor)") + def _is_xpc_error(self, error: Exception) -> bool: + """ + Check if an error is an XPC connection error (macOS daemon issue). + + On macOS, long-running daemons can lose XPC connections to system services + when the process is idle for extended periods. + """ + error_str = str(error).lower() + return "xpc_error_connection_invalid" in error_str or "xpc error" in error_str + + def _reinitialize_model_sync(self) -> None: + """ + Clear and reinitialize the cross-encoder model synchronously. + + This is used to recover from XPC errors on macOS where the + PyTorch/MPS backend loses its connection to system services. + """ + logger.warning(f"Reinitializing reranker model {self.model_name} due to backend error") + + # Clear existing model + self._model = None + + # Force garbage collection to free resources + import gc + + import torch + + gc.collect() + + # If using CUDA/MPS, clear the cache + if torch.cuda.is_available(): + torch.cuda.empty_cache() + elif hasattr(torch.backends, "mps") and torch.backends.mps.is_available(): + try: + torch.mps.empty_cache() + except AttributeError: + pass # Method might not exist in all PyTorch versions + + # Reinitialize the model + try: + from sentence_transformers import CrossEncoder + except ImportError: + raise ImportError( + "sentence-transformers is required for LocalSTCrossEncoder. " + "Install it with: pip install sentence-transformers" + ) + + # Determine device based on hardware availability + has_gpu = torch.cuda.is_available() or (hasattr(torch.backends, "mps") and torch.backends.mps.is_available()) + + if has_gpu: + device = None # Let sentence-transformers auto-detect GPU/MPS + else: + device = "cpu" + + self._model = CrossEncoder( + self.model_name, + device=device, + model_kwargs={"low_cpu_mem_usage": False}, + ) + + logger.info("Reranker: local provider reinitialized successfully") + + def _predict_with_recovery(self, pairs: list[tuple[str, str]]) -> list[float]: + """ + Predict with automatic recovery from XPC errors. + + This runs synchronously in the thread pool. + """ + max_retries = 1 + for attempt in range(max_retries + 1): + try: + scores = self._model.predict(pairs, show_progress_bar=False) + return scores.tolist() if hasattr(scores, "tolist") else list(scores) + except Exception as e: + # Check if this is an XPC error (macOS daemon issue) + if self._is_xpc_error(e) and attempt < max_retries: + logger.warning(f"XPC error detected in reranker (attempt {attempt + 1}): {e}") + try: + self._reinitialize_model_sync() + logger.info("Reranker reinitialized successfully, retrying prediction") + continue + except Exception as reinit_error: + logger.error(f"Failed to reinitialize reranker: {reinit_error}") + raise Exception(f"Failed to recover from XPC error: {str(e)}") + else: + # Not an XPC error or out of retries + raise + async def predict(self, pairs: list[tuple[str, str]]) -> list[float]: """ Score query-document pairs for relevance. Uses a dedicated thread pool with limited workers to prevent CPU thrashing. + Automatically recovers from XPC errors on macOS by reinitializing the model. Args: pairs: List of (query, document) tuples to score @@ -180,11 +270,11 @@ class LocalSTCrossEncoder(CrossEncoderModel): # Use dedicated executor - limited workers naturally limits concurrency loop = asyncio.get_event_loop() - scores = await loop.run_in_executor( + return await loop.run_in_executor( LocalSTCrossEncoder._executor, - lambda: self._model.predict(pairs, show_progress_bar=False), + self._predict_with_recovery, + pairs, ) - return scores.tolist() if hasattr(scores, "tolist") else list(scores) class RemoteTEICrossEncoder(CrossEncoderModel): diff --git a/hindsight-api/hindsight_api/engine/embeddings.py b/hindsight-api/hindsight_api/engine/embeddings.py index 3ab3aefc..dddee9d5 100644 --- a/hindsight-api/hindsight_api/engine/embeddings.py +++ b/hindsight-api/hindsight_api/engine/embeddings.py @@ -151,10 +151,75 @@ class LocalSTEmbeddings(Embeddings): self._dimension = self._model.get_sentence_embedding_dimension() logger.info(f"Embeddings: local provider initialized (dim: {self._dimension})") + def _is_xpc_error(self, error: Exception) -> bool: + """ + Check if an error is an XPC connection error (macOS daemon issue). + + On macOS, long-running daemons can lose XPC connections to system services + when the process is idle for extended periods. + """ + error_str = str(error).lower() + return "xpc_error_connection_invalid" in error_str or "xpc error" in error_str + + def _reinitialize_model_sync(self) -> None: + """ + Clear and reinitialize the embedding model synchronously. + + This is used to recover from XPC errors on macOS where the + PyTorch/MPS backend loses its connection to system services. + """ + logger.warning(f"Reinitializing embedding model {self.model_name} due to backend error") + + # Clear existing model + self._model = None + + # Force garbage collection to free resources + import gc + + import torch + + gc.collect() + + # If using CUDA/MPS, clear the cache + if torch.cuda.is_available(): + torch.cuda.empty_cache() + elif hasattr(torch.backends, "mps") and torch.backends.mps.is_available(): + try: + torch.mps.empty_cache() + except AttributeError: + pass # Method might not exist in all PyTorch versions + + # Reinitialize the model (inline version of initialize() but synchronous) + try: + from sentence_transformers import SentenceTransformer + except ImportError: + raise ImportError( + "sentence-transformers is required for LocalSTEmbeddings.
